Form Guide & Team Overview

Crystal Palace

Crystal Palace are in good nick, unbeaten in their last three matches. Their 3-0 thrashing of Aston Villa away from home shows they've got the firepower to hurt teams. The draws against Nottingham Forest and Chelsea prove they can hold their own against tough opposition. This form should give them confidence going into the match against Sunderland.

Recent Premier League Results:

  • Win: 3-0 vs Aston Villa (A)

  • Draw: 1-1 vs Nottingham Forest (H)

  • Draw: 0-0 vs Chelsea (A)

Sunderland

Sunderland have had mixed results recently. They've managed to win both their home games convincingly, but their away form let them down against Burnley. They'll need to be more solid defensively if they're to get anything from this trip to Crystal Palace. It's a big test for them, but they've shown they can rise to the occasion at times.

Recent Premier League Results:

  • Win: 2-1 vs Brentford (H)

  • Loss: 0-2 vs Burnley (A)

  • Win: 3-0 vs West Ham United (H)

Head-to-Head Record

Historically, there’s very little to choose between the teams, with both claiming two wins and a draw in the last five encounters. Interestingly, there have been plenty of goals in these matches for both sides.

Recent Results

  • Crystal Palace 0-4 Sunderland (04 Feb 2017)

  • Sunderland 2-3 Crystal Palace (24 Sep 2016)

  • Sunderland 2-2 Crystal Palace (01 Mar 2016)

  • Crystal Palace 0-1 Sunderland (23 Nov 2015)

  • Sunderland 1-4 Crystal Palace (11 Apr 2015)

Team News & Injury Report

Crystal Palace

  • Chadi Riad (Cruciate Ligament) - Out

  • Eddie Nketiah (Hamstring) - Out

  • Cheick Doucouré (Knee) - Out

  • Adam Wharton (Muscle) - Doubt

  • Ismaïla Sarr (Hamstring) - Doubt

  • Caleb Kporha (Back) - Doubt

Sunderland

  • Daniel Ballard (Groin) - Out

  • Romaine Mundle (Hamstring) - Out

  • Aji Alese (Shoulder) - Doubt

  • Leo Hjelde (Achilles Tendon) - Doubt

  • Luke O’Nien (Shoulder) - Doubt

  • Dennis Cirkin (Wrist) - Doubt
